Q: Is 13,751,460 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 13,751,460 is a composite number.

Why is 13,751,460 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 13,751,460 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 9 10 12 15 18 20 30 36 45 60 90 180 241 317 482 634 723 951 964 1,205 1,268 1,446 1,585 1,902 2,169 2,410 2,853 2,892 3,170 3,615 3,804 4,338 4,755 4,820 5,706 6,340 7,230 8,676 9,510 10,845 11,412 14,265 14,460 19,020 21,690 28,530 43,380 57,060 76,397 152,794 229,191 305,588 381,985 458,382 687,573 763,970 916,764 1,145,955 1,375,146 1,527,940 2,291,910 2,750,292 3,437,865 4,583,820 6,875,730 and 13,751,460, with no remainder.

Since 13,751,460 cannot be divided by just 1 and 13,751,460, it is a composite number.
